Oracle XE 11g with Apex No Listener Issue (ORA-12541: TNS:no listener)
1007611May 7 2013 — edited May 8 2013Hi Guys,
I am using Oracle XE 11g with Apex 4.2 installed. It was working fine till yesterday. Suddenly today morning I received the ORA-12541: TNS:no listener when tried to open Apex url.
I had gone through many threads in this forum and tried many suggested workaround but unfortunately nothing worked. So I am completely lost now.
Here is the various o/p of the issues. I am on Windows 7 x64. Its my own laptop so no host named changed from yesterday.
Listener file
----------------------------------
SID_LIST_LISTENER =
(SID_LIST =
(SID_DESC =
(SID_NAME = XE)
(ORACLE_HOME = F:\Apex_Installed\app\oracle\product\11.2.0\server)
)
(SID_DESC =
(SID_NAME = PLSExtProc)
(ORACLE_HOME = F:\Apex_Installed\app\oracle\product\11.2.0\server)
(PROGRAM = extproc)
)
(SID_DESC =
(SID_NAME = CLRExtProc)
(ORACLE_HOME = F:\Apex_Installed\app\oracle\product\11.2.0\server)
(PROGRAM = extproc)
)
)
LISTENER =
(DESCRIPTION_LIST =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1))
(ADDRESS = (PROTOCOL = TCP)(HOST = 127.0.0.1)(PORT = 1521))
)
)
DEFAULT_SERVICE_LISTENER = (XE)
-------------------------------------------------------------------
TNS Ora file
XE =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ST = 127.0.0.1)(PORT = 1521))
(CONNECT_DATA =
(SERVER = DEDICATED)
(SERVICE_NAME = XE)
)
)
EXTPROC_CONNECTION_DATA =
(DESCRIPTION =
(ADDRESS_LIST =
(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1))
)
(CONNECT_DATA =
(SID = PLSExtProc)
(PRESENTATION = RO)
)
)
ORACLR_CONNECTION_DATA =
(DESCRIPTION =
(ADDRESS_LIST =
(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1))
)
(CONNECT_DATA =
(SID = CLRExtProc)
(PRESENTATION = RO)
)
)
----------------------------------------------------------------------------
After running LSNRCTL.exe o/p is below:
C:\Users\Rocks>lsnrctl.exe
LSNRCTL for 32-bit Windows: Version 11.2.0.2.0 - Production on 07-MAY-2013 19:53
:24
Copyright (c) 1991, 2010, Oracle. All rights reserved.
Welcome to LSNRCTL, type "help" for information.
LSNRCTL> services
Connecting to (DESCRIPTION=(ADDRESS=(PROTOCOL=IPC)(KEY=EXTPROC1)))
TNS-12541: TNS:no listener
TNS-12560: TNS:protocol adapter error
TNS-00511: No listener
32-bit Windows Error: 2: No such file or directory
Connecting to (D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=127.0.0.1)(PORT=1521)))
TNS-12541: TNS:no listener
TNS-12560: TNS:protocol adapter error
TNS-00511: No listener
32-bit Windows Error: 61: Unknown error
LSNRCTL> start
Starting tnslsnr: please wait...
TNS-12560: TNS:protocol adapter error
TNS-00530: Protocol adapter error
LSNRCTL> stop
Connecting to (DESCRIPTION=(ADDRESS=(PROTOCOL=IPC)(KEY=EXTPROC1)))
TNS-12541: TNS:no listener
TNS-12560: TNS:protocol adapter error
TNS-00511: No listener
32-bit Windows Error: 2: No such file or directory
Connecting to (D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=127.0.0.1)(PORT=1521)))
TNS-12541: TNS:no listener
TNS-12560: TNS:protocol adapter error
TNS-00511: No listener
32-bit Windows Error: 61: Unknown error
LSNRCTL>
--------------------------------------------------------------------
I am able to connect SYSTEM user but when trying to connect XE database its throwing error.
C:\Users\Rocks>sqlplus /nolog
SQL*Plus: Release 11.2.0.2.0 Production on Tue May 7 19:39:03 2013
Copyright (c) 1982, 2010, Oracle. All rights reserved.
SQL> connect system
Enter password:
Connected.
SQL>
SQL>
SQL>
SQL>
SQL>
SQL> alter system register;
System altered.
SQL> connect suvendu@xe
Enter password:
ERROR:
ORA-12541: TNS:no listener
Warning: You are no longer connected to ORACLE.
SQL> connect admin@xe
Enter password:
ERROR:
ORA-12541: TNS:no listener
SQL> exit
-----------------------------------------------------------------
Here is the o/p of different Environment variable.
C:\Users\Rocks>set|sort
ALLUSERSPROFILE=C:\ProgramData
APPDATA=C:\Users\Rocks\AppData\Roaming
CommonProgramFiles(x86)=C:\Program Files (x86)\Common Files
CommonProgramFiles=C:\Program Files\Common Files
CommonProgramW6432=C:\Program Files\Common Files
COMPUTERNAME=ROCKS-LAPI
ComSpec=C:\Windows\system32\cmd.exe
FP_NO_HOST_CHECK=NO
HOMEDRIVE=C:
HOMEPATH=\Users\Rocks
LOCALAPPDATA=C:\Users\Rocks\AppData\Local
LOGONSERVER=\\ROCKS-LAPI
NUMBER_OF_PROCESSORS=4
ORACLE_HOME=F:\Apex_Installed\app\oracle\product\11.2.0\server
ORACLE_SID=XE
ORACLE_UNQNAME=XE
OS=Windows_NT
Path=F:\Apex_Installed\app\oracle\product\11.2.0\server\bin;F:\Apex_Installed\ap
p\oracle\product\11.2.0\server\bin;F:\Apex_Installed\app\oracle\product\11.2.0\s
erver\bin;C:\Program Files (x86)\Intel\iCLS Client\;C:\Program Files\Intel\iCLS
Client\;C:\Windows\system32;C:\Windows;C:\Windows\System32\Wbem;C:\Windows\Syste
m32\WindowsPowerShell\v1.0\;C:\Program Files\Intel\Intel(R) Management Engine Co
mponents\DAL;C:\Program Files\Intel\Intel(R) Management Engine Components\IPT;C:
\Program Files (x86)\Intel\Intel(R) Management Engine Components\DAL;C:\Program
Files (x86)\Intel\Intel(R) Management Engine Components\IPT;C:\Program Files (x8
6)\Intel\OpenCL SDK\2.0\bin\x86;C:\Program Files (x86)\Intel\OpenCL SDK\2.0\bin\
x64;C:\Program Files (x86)\Hewlett-Packard\HP ProtectTools Security Manager\Bin\
PATHEXT=.COM;.EXE;.BAT;.CMD;.VBS;.VBE;.JS;.JSE;.WSF;.WSH;.MSC
PROCESSOR_ARCHITECTURE=AMD64
PROCESSOR_IDENTIFIER=Intel64 Family 6 Model 42 Stepping 7, GenuineIntel
PROCESSOR_LEVEL=6
PROCESSOR_REVISION=2a07
ProgramData=C:\ProgramData
ProgramFiles(x86)=C:\Program Files (x86)
ProgramFiles=C:\Program Files
ProgramW6432=C:\Program Files
PROMPT=$P$G
PSModulePath=C:\Windows\system32\WindowsPowerShell\v1.0\Modules\
PTSMInstallPath_X86=C:\Program Files (x86)\Hewlett-Packard\HP ProtectTools Secur
ity Manager\
PUBLIC=C:\Users\Public
SESSIONNAME=Console
SystemDrive=C:
SystemRoot=C:\Windows
TEMP=C:\Users\Rocks\AppData\Local\Temp
TMP=C:\Users\Rocks\AppData\Local\Temp
USERDOMAIN=Rocks-Lapi
USERNAME=Rocks
USERPROFILE=C:\Users\Rocks
windir=C:\Windows
windows_tracing_flags=3
windows_tracing_logfile=C:\BVTBin\Tests\installpackage\csilogfile.log
--------------------------------------------------------------------------------------------------------
In Windows Services Menu I have only two services.
OracleJobSchedulerXE
OracleServiceXE
No Listener Service ---- hopefully this won't be an issue.
--------------------------------------------------
Everything looks fine to me but not sure why its not working. I am working on a project in Apex so cant uninstall the data application right now.
May I request you to help me please?
Thanks in advance.
Regards,
Suvendu